A copper-selective electrode based on bis(acetylacetone)propylenediimine
Authors:Gupta V K  Goyal R N  Bachheti N  Singh L P  Agarwal S
Institution:a Department of Chemistry, Indian Institute of Technology Roorkee, Roorkee 247667, India
b Central Building Research Institute (CBRI), Roorkee 247667, India
Abstract:The potentiometric response characteristics of Cu2+-selective electrodes based on bis(acetylacetone)propylenediimine (I) combined with anion localizing agent (sodium tetraphenyl borate (NaTPB)) and solvent mediators (dibutyl butyl phosphonate (DBBP), tri-n-butyl phosphate (TBP) and chloronaphthalene (CN)) were investigated. The best results for Cu2+ sensing was obtained for the electrode membrane containing PVC, I, DBBP and NaTPB in composition 5:100:200:6 (I:PVC:DBBP:NaTPB) (w/w; mg), where the electrode had a Nernstian response (30.0 mV/decade) to Cu2+ within the concentration range 1.0 × 10−5 to 1.0 × 10−1 M and detection limit of 0.5 ppm. The operational pH range of the electrode was 3.3-7.0. Selectivity characteristic of the proposed electrode was also assessed by calculating View the MathML source using fixed interference method matched potential method. The sensor has been successfully used in the potentiometric titration of copper ions with EDTA.
Keywords:Ion-selective electrodes  Copper  Bis(acetylacetone)propylenediimine
